Patients with severe trauma require an extremely timely treatment and transfusion plays an irreplaceable role in the emergency treatment of such patients. An increasing number of evidence-based medicinal evidences and clinical practices suggest that patients with severe traumatic bleeding benefit from early transfusion of low-titer group O whole blood or hemostatic resuscitation with red blood cells, plasma and platelet of a balanced ratio. However, the current domestic mode of blood supply cannot fully meet the requirements of timely and effective blood transfusion for emergency treatment of patients with severe trauma in clinical practice. In order to solve the key problems in blood supply and blood transfusion strategies for emergency treatment of severe trauma, Branch of Clinical Transfusion Medicine of Chinese Medical Association, Group for Trauma Emergency Care and Multiple Injuries of Trauma Branch of Chinese Medical Association, Young Scholar Group of Disaster Medicine Branch of Chinese Medical Association organized domestic experts of blood transfusion medicine and trauma treatment to jointly formulate Chinese expert consensus on blood support mode and blood transfusion strategies for emergency treatment of severe trauma patients ( version 2024). Based on the evidence-based medical evidence and Delphi method of expert consultation and voting, 10 recommendations were put forward from two aspects of blood support mode and transfusion strategies, aiming to provide a reference for transfusion resuscitation in the emergency treatment of severe trauma and further improve the success rate of treatment of patients with severe trauma.

Primary central nervous system lymphoma (PCNSL) is a rare and aggressive non-Hodgkin’s lymphoma that affects the brain, eyes, cerebrospinal fluid, or spinal cord without systemic involvement. The outcome of patients with PCNSL is worse compared to patients with systemic diffuse large B-cell lymphoma. Given potential mortality associated with severe immune effector cell-associated neurotoxicity syndrome (ICANS), patients with PCNSL have been excluded from most clinical trials involving chimeric antigen receptor T-cell (CAR-T) therapy initially. Here, we report for the first time to apply decitabine-primed tandem CD19/CD22 dual-targeted CAR-T therapy with programmed cell death-1 (PD-1) and Bruton’s tyrosine kinase (BTK) inhibitors maintenance in one patient with multiline-resistant refractory PCNSL and the patient has maintained complete remission (CR) for a 35-month follow-up period. This case represents the first successful treatment of multiline resistant refractory PCNSL with long-term CR and without inducing ICANS under tandem CD19/CD22 bispecific CAR-T therapy followed by maintenance therapy with PD-1 and BTK inhibitors. This study shows tremendous potential in the treatment of PCNSL and offers a look toward ongoing clinical studies.

Objective To investigate micro-inflammatory state and protein-energy wasting (PEW) states in maintenance peritoneal dialysis(MPD) patients,then analysis of the correlation between them.Methods Ninty-six cases of MPD patients in this Hospital were selected from March 2012 to September 2015.The status of nutrition were assessed by Quantitative Subjective and global Assessment(SGA),malnutrition-inflammation score(MIS) and albumin(Alb),micro-inflammatory state was assessed by enzyme-linked immunoassay(ELISA) method serum hypersensitive c-reactive protein (hs-CRP),tumor necrosis factor-α(TNF-α),interleukin-6(IL-6).At the same time,various serological markers like serum Alb,serum total protein(TP),serum prealbumin(PA),hemoglobin(Hb),transferrin(TF),serum creatinine(Scr),urea nitrogen(BUN),cholesterol(Teh) were measured.Results The incidence of PEW in MPD patients was 36.50%,among which 62.86 % of them were over 65 years old,57.10% were over 2 years of dialysis time and 40.00% with diabetic nephropathy.MPD patients with hs-CRP>5 mg/L accounted for 58.33%,of which over 65 year old accounted for 42.86%,MPD age longer than 2 years accounted for 60.71%,32.14% of them with diabetic nephropathy.The proportion of diabetic nephropathy,average age,dialysis duration time,hs-CRP,TNF-α and IL-6 in PEW group were higher than non-PEW group(P<0.05);BM,TP,Alb,PA,Hb,TCh,MAC and MAMC were lower ban non-PEW group(P<0.05).Compared with the hs-CRP≤5 mg/L group,average age,the time of dialysis duration,TNF-α,IL-6 were higher and TP,Alb,PA,TF,Hb,the proportion of Kt/V≥1.72 were lower in the hs-CRP>5 mg/L group.After the correction of age,sex,dialysis ages,it was found that the level of hs-CRP in MPD patients was negatively correlated with the level of Alb,PA,TF,Tch,Scr,TG;The level of IL-6 was negatively correlated with the levels of Alb,PA,TF,Tch,TG.The level of TNF-α in MPD patients showed different degrees of negative correlation with the leves of Alb,PA,TF,TG,Tch(all P<0.05).Multivariate analysis showed that elderly,the time of dialysis duration,the microinflammatory state,and hypoalbuminemia were the independent risk factors of PEW.Conclusion PEW and micro-inflammatory state are very common in PHD patients.Patients with longer duration of dialysis,elderly or associated with diabetic nephropathy are more likely to suffer PEW and micro-inflammatory.Elderly,the time of dialysis duration,microinflammatory state,hypoalbuminemia are the independent risk factors of PEW.

Objective To discuss the effect of mind map combined with physical care in the prevention and treatment of stroke for elderly patients with hypertensionin community.Methods A total of 100 cases of elderly patients with hypertension from March to September 2015 who met the inclusion criteria were included in the study. According to random numbers generated by the computer, patients were randomly divided into intervention group and control group, 50 cases respectively. The two groups were followed up routinely. Patients in the intervention group were guided by the mind map combined with physical care. The mind map was made and designed to assess the patient's constitution. Individualized health guidance was developed according to the patient's physique identification. The intervention time was 24 weeks. The self-management behavior,systolic blood pressure, diastolic blood pressure, biased syndrome, and stroke morbidity before and after the intervention were compared between the two groups.Results Before the intervention, there were no significant differences in self-management behavior, systolic blood pressure, diastolic blood pressure, biased syndrome and stroke morbidity between the two groups (P>0.05). After the intervention, dietetic adjust and nursing, sports health, emotion transfer, daily life transfer, regularly blood pressure checking in the intervention group were significantly better than those in the control group; and the scores of self-management behavior increased compared with those before the intervention; BMI, systolic blood pressure, diastolic blood pressure, and biased syndrome score were significantly lower than those in the control group and before the intervention; Control rate of blood pressure was 78% in the intervention group, which was significantly higher than that in the control group (46%) (P<0.05). The incidence of stroke was 20% in the intervention group, which was lower than that in the control group (40%), with no statistically significant difference between the two groups (P>0.05). Conclusions Mind map combined with physical care can improve the self-management behavior of patients with hypertension in the community, and reduce diastolic blood pressure, systolic blood pressure and biased syndrome. However, the effect in the prevention of stroke requires further investigations.

OBJECTIVE:
To explore the molecular mechanism of human corpus myometrium contraction related proteins and parturition.
METHODS:
The proteins of human corpus of myometrium tissues from full term non-in labor (38- 41 weeks amenorrhea) and full term in labor (38-41 weeks amenorrhea) gravidas were separated by 2-dimensional gel electrophoresis (2-GE), respectively. Then gels were stained by Coomassie brilliant blue G250, scanned by Image scanner and analyzed with PDQuest software. The differentially expressed protein spots of corpus myometrium between the 2 groups were identified by peptide mass finger print based on matrix-assisted laser desorption/ionization time of flight mass spectrometry (MALDI-TOF-MS) and database searching. Three identified differentially expressed proteins were confirmed by Western blot.
RESULTS:
Well resolved and reproducible 2D-GE maps of human corpus myometrium from non-in labor and in-labor gravidas were acquired. Twenty more than 2-fold differentially expressed protein spots were identified by MALDI-TOF-MS. These proteins were involved in cell structure, calcium binding, chaperone, energy metabolism, signal transduction, and antioxidant.
CONCLUSION
Twenty contraction related proteins of human corpus myometrium have been identified, indicating that cell structure and calcium-binding are important reasons for the contraction of human corpus myometrium.

Objective To investigate the expression of HIF-1α protein in the placenta bed and the concentration of von Willrand factor (vWF) in maternal peripheral blood from pre-eclampsia and normal pregnancy, and to determine the effect of HIF-1α and vWF on the pathogenesis of pre-eclampsia. Methods Forty pre-eclampsia patients (20 mild and 20 severe) were recruited as 2 study groups, and another 20 normal pregnant women were served as a normal group.Western blot was used to detect the expression of HIF-1α protein in the placenta bed. ELISA was adopted to detect the concentration of vWF in the maternal peripheral blood.Correlation between HIF-1α protein expression and vWF level was analyzed by Spearman method.Results The expression of HIF-1α protein in the placenta bed was the highest in the severe pre-eclampsia patients among 3 groups, followed by the mild pre-eclampsia patients and the normal controls.There was significant difference (among) 3 groups (P<0.001).The concentration of vWF in the maternal peripheral blood was the highest in the severe pre-eclampsia patients, followed by the mild pre-eclampsia patients and the normal controls.There was significant difference among the 3 groups (P<0.05). Postive correlation was found between the expression of HIF-1α protein in the placenta bed and the concentration of vWF in the maternal peripheral blood in patients with pre-eclampsia (r_1=(0.65,) P<(0.001)),and between the concentration of vWF in the maternal peripheral blood and the pathogenetic condition degree of pre-eclampsia (r_2=(0.61,)P<0.001).Conclusion HIF-1α in coordination with vWF may play an important role in the pathogenesis of pre-eclampsia.

OBJECTIVE:
To investigate the expression of Calponin-1 and Transgenlin in the uterine smooth muscles during normal labor on-sets, and to evaluate their effect on initiating the normal labor.
METHODS:
A total of 14 uterine bodies and lower segments of human pregnancy were divided to a non-labor group (NIL) and a labor group(IL). Immunohistochemical technology and Western blot were used to determine the expression of Calponin-1 and Transgelin in the 2 groups.
RESULTS:
Immunohistochemical detection and Western blot showed that Calponin-1 protein in the uterine smooth muscle tissue of the body and the lower uterine segment of smooth muscle tissues had significant difference (P<0.05). The expression of Transgelin in the uterine body smooth muscle tissue in the IL was higher than that in the NIL(P<0.05). In the lower uterine segments of the smooth muscle, the expression of Transgelin was not significantly different in the 2 groups (P>0.05).
CONCLUSION
Calponin-1 of the uterine smooth muscle and Transgelin of the uterine body smooth muscle may involve in the regulation of uterine smooth muscle contractility, which is closely related to child birth launch.

Objective To investigate the effect of Calponin-1 suppression on human myometrium cells through adenovirus mediated siRNA. Methods Human uterine smooth muscle tissues were digested with enzymes, cultured and confirmed with immunocytochemistry. Aadenovirus siRNA-Calponin-1 plasmid was transfected into primary cultured uterine smooth muscle cells in vitro. The expressions of Calponin-1 mRNA and protein were analyzed by RT-PCR and Western blot, respectively.Results The pAdEasy-pShuttle-U6-Calponin-1 siRNA plasmid was successfully constructed, and Calponin-1 siRNA mediated by recombinant adenovirus resulted in markedly reduced expression of Calponin-1 mRNA and protein in human myometrium cells. The gray values of Calponin-1 mRNA in the uterine smooth muscle cells in the experimental, blank control, and empty vector groups were 316.3±39.2, 1048.5±126.4 and 1027.2±127.5, respectively. The gray values of Calponin-1 protein were 323.3±43.2, 1021.5±143.4, and 1019.2±144.5,respectively. The difference between the experimental group and the blank control group as well as the empty vector group was significant (P< 0.05). There was no significant difference between the empty vector group and the blank control group (P>0.05).Conclusion The pAdEasy-pShuttle-U6-Calponin-1 siRNA plasmid can inhibit the expression of Calponin-1 in human myometrium cells in vitro,which may be a useful approach to determine the role of Calponin-1 in delivery.

OBJECTIVE:
To investigate the effect of human papillomavirus types 16E6 on the sensitivity of chemotherapy for cervical carcinoma in different p53 genotype cell lines.
METHODS:
The apoptosis rates of each group were detected by AO/EB, immunofluorescence and Annexin V/PI stained methods. The expressions of protein HPV16E6 and p53(mt) after the treatments of different concentration of DDP were detected by Western blot. HPV16E6 mRNA in C33A, C33A-E6, C33A-P, and CaSki cell lines under different DDP treatments were detected by RT-PCR.
RESULTS:
AO/EB and Annexin V/PI stained tests showed that the apoptosis rates of C33A, C33A-E6, C33A-P, and CaSki cells were significantly increased when DDP concentration increased. Western blot showed that the HPV16E6 protein could be detected only in C33A-E6 and CaSki cell lines. The expression of HPV16E6 protein in C33A-E6 and CaSki cell lines gradually decreased and was hardly detected with increased dosage of DDP and the prolonged treatment time (P<0.01), and slightly increased in C33A-E6 and Caski cell lines without the treatment, but there was no significant difference between them (P>0.05). Protein p53(mt) persistently expressed in C33A-E6, C33A, and C33A-P cell lines following the increased dosage of DDP and the prolonged treatment time(P>0.05), while it couldn't be found in CaSki cell line. RT-PCR showed that without DDP intervention, there was no significant difference of HPV16E6 mRNA in C33A-E6 and CaSki cell lines within 24 h.The HPV16E6 mRNA in C33A-E6 cell line expressed much higher than that in CaSki (P<0.05), and HPV16E6 mRNA of 2 cell lines expressed much higher at 48 h than at 24 h (P<0.05).The expression of HPV16E6 mRNA in C33A-E6 and CaSki cell lines gradually decreased with the increased DDP and prolonged treatment time (P<0.01), while there was no significant difference between C33A-E6 and CaSki cell lines under the same DDP concentration (P>0.05).
CONCLUSION
Effect of HPV16E6 on the sensitivity of chemotherapy for cervical carcinoma cell lines is not markedly related with the different p53 genotype forms(p53(mt)/p53wt ). HPV16E6 may affect the proliferation and sensitivity of chemotherapy in C33A cell line through other mechanism.

OBJECTIVE:
To determine the difference in aspartyl-(asparaginyl) beta-hydroxylase (AAH) expression level in villi between patients with missed abortion and normal women with early pregnancy, and to confirm the expression loci of AAH in villi.
METHODS:
A total of 50 patients of missed abortion were collected and categorized into a test group, which was subdivided into Group 1 and Group 2. Patients in Group 1 (n=20) were of confirmed etiological disorders while those in Group 2 (n=30) showed no obviously etiological clues. In addition, 20 women of early pregnancy with artificial abortion were categorized into a control group, whose embryos were sonographically confirmed alive before surgery. The 50 patients of missed abortion were also subdivided into a group within 4 weeks and a group over 4 weeks according to the time that the embryo stayed in utrine after death. Immunohistochemical technique and computer image analysis were used to detect the expression loci and the level of AAH in villi.
RESULTS:
AAH was expressed in the endochylema and nucleus of trephocyte both in missed abortion and normal early pregnancy. The expression level of AAH in villi of missed abortion was much lower than that of in villi of normal early pregnancy (P<0.05). The expression level had no difference between different groups of patients with missed abortion(P>0.05).
CONCLUSION
Low expression of AAH in the endochylema and nucleus of trephocyte may play a role in patients with missed abortion.
